<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    blog.Toby

      BlogJava :: 首頁 :: 新隨筆 :: 聯系 :: 聚合  :: 管理 ::
      130 隨筆 :: 2 文章 :: 150 評論 :: 0 Trackbacks

    要想在腳本組件中訪問包變量,首先必須設置腳本組件2個屬性的值,如下
    ReadOnlyVariables
    ReadWriteVariables
    這2值指定了哪些變量可以訪問,哪些變量可以改寫(如有多個變量則用逗號分隔),如果你沒有指定上面2個屬性的值,則不能在腳本組件的代碼中訪問包變量

    下面我舉一個從文件中加載內容到包變量的一個例子
     1、首先我們定義2個變量 FileName 和 FileContents ,并指定其類型為 String
     2、拖曳一個腳本組件到控制面板上,并設置 ReadOnlyVariables和ReadWriteVariables 屬性的值分別為 FileName 、FileContents
     3、設計腳本組件的代碼,如下 
     

     Public Sub Main()
             Dim errorInfo As String = ""
             Dim Contents As String = ""
     
             Contents = GetFileContents(Dts.Variables("FileName").Value, errorInfo)
             If errorInfo.Length > 0 Then
                 MsgBox(errorInfo, MsgBoxStyle.Critical, "Error")
                 Dts.TaskResult = Dts.Results.Failure
             Else
                 MsgBox(Contents, MsgBoxStyle.OKOnly, "File contents")
                 Dts.Variables("FileContents").Value=Contents
                 Dts.TaskResult = Dts.Results.Success
             End If
      End Sub

     Public Function GetFileContents(ByVal filePath As String, Optional ByVal ErrorInfo As String = "") As String
            Dim strContents As String
            Dim objReader As StreamReader
            Try
                objReader = New StreamReader(filePath)
                strContents = objReader.ReadToEnd()
                objReader.Close()
                Return strContents
            Catch Ex As Exception
                ErrorInfo = Ex.Message
            End Try
        End Function

    posted on 2007-10-14 20:49 渠上月 閱讀(325) 評論(0)  編輯  收藏 所屬分類: VS 2005
    主站蜘蛛池模板: 成人无码a级毛片免费| 国产成人免费在线| 久久精品国产亚洲AV电影| 99久久国产免费中文无字幕| 亚洲欧美黑人猛交群| 自拍偷自拍亚洲精品第1页| 人与禽交免费网站视频| 特级毛片免费播放| 亚洲电影在线播放| 亚洲国产精品人人做人人爽| 91久久青青草原线免费| 亚洲av无码一区二区三区人妖 | 国产在线观看免费av站| 亚洲欧洲日韩不卡| 免费a级黄色毛片| 日本免费一区二区三区四区五六区| 亚洲性线免费观看视频成熟| 超清首页国产亚洲丝袜| 成人在线免费观看| 欧洲精品99毛片免费高清观看| 另类图片亚洲校园小说区| 精品日韩亚洲AV无码一区二区三区 | 三年片在线观看免费观看大全一 | 午夜无码A级毛片免费视频| 美国毛片亚洲社区在线观看| 久久久久久久亚洲Av无码| 亚洲视频在线一区二区| 毛片免费在线播放| 5555在线播放免费播放| 久久久久免费视频| 怡红院亚洲红怡院在线观看| 亚洲伊人久久大香线焦| 无码欧精品亚洲日韩一区| 亚洲伊人久久成综合人影院| 免费人成视频在线| 亚洲免费观看在线视频| 97人妻精品全国免费视频| 亚洲乱色熟女一区二区三区蜜臀| 久久亚洲精品成人av无码网站| 亚洲色婷婷六月亚洲婷婷6月 | 亚洲视频免费一区|